Position Summary:
The Behavior Analyst position will provide individualized behavioral services to clients, ages 7-17. Duties may include screening for potential services, development of a behavior plan when indicated by the results of the comprehensive behavioral assessment, 1:1 direct or supervised ABA therapy, and ongoing analysis of the treatment plan for each client. The Behavior Analyst will train and supervise Registered Behavior Technicians, graph and analyze data, and program plan. In addition, this position will work on a supportive and dynamic therapeutic team to address each client’s needs and serve as a consultant for other clinical staff serving the client. This position is required to maintain the behavioral record for their client list including ongoing data analysis, treatment plans, parent trainings, and treatment updates in a timely, professional manner. To provide therapeutic services within the scope of licensure, training, protocols, and competence and within purview of statutes applicable to the position. Therapeutic services include but are not limited to behavioral reviews, assessment, treatment planning, direct service provision, person centered services and management of client risk and safety. Role Requirements:
- Master’s Degree in Social Services (psychology, social work, or a related human services field)
- Certified/Eligible National Board-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) and maintain active certification OR
- Hold an active Florida license as a clinical social worker, mental health counselor, marriage and family therapist
- Two (2) years’ experience working with: children and adolescents (up to age 21)
- Eligible to participate in state or federally funded programs such as Medicaid
- Must be able to provide individualized applied behavior analysis services to meet the needs of individuals served and their families
- Must be able to pass organization screening requirements, including state or federal background screenings as appropriate.
- Must possess a valid driver’s license from the state in which you reside, a good driving record and be insurable under the corporate policy.
